According to the latest report released by South Korean market research firm SNE Research, BYD has surpassed LG Energy and ranked second among global electric vehicle battery suppliers with a market share of 16.2%. The report also mentioned that CATL continued to hold the top position in the electric vehicle battery industry, supplying Tesla Model 3, Model Y and other models, with a market share of 35%. This means that in the global electric vehicle battery supplier list, China's CATL and BYD took the first and second place, with a combined market share of more than 50%. In addition, the report showed that the total global electric vehicle battery consumption in the first quarter was 133.0GWh, an increase of 38.6% from 95.9GWh in the same period last year. Among them, CATL installed 46.6GWh of batteries in the first quarter, an increase of 35.9% from 34.3GWh in the same period last year. BYD installed 21.5GWh of power batteries in the first quarter, an increase of 115.5% from 10.0GWh in the same period last year.
